Myth #1: Red Light Therapy Is a Gimmick

The Truth:
Red light therapy is backed by decades of scientific research. Numerous studies have demonstrated its ability to stimulate cellular repair, increase collagen production, and reduce inflammation. For example, a 2013 study published in Seminars in Cutaneous Medicine and Surgery highlighted RLT’s effectiveness in treating wrinkles, improving skin tone, and healing wounds.

Unlike unproven fads, red light therapy’s benefits are supported by rigorous research, making it a legitimate and valuable tool for skin health, pain relief, and more.

Myth #2: Red Light Therapy Works Instantly

The Truth:
While some users notice subtle improvements after the first few sessions, red light therapy is not a quick fix. Its effectiveness lies in consistent, long-term use. Regular treatments allow RLT to stimulate collagen production, enhance circulation, and support cellular regeneration, leading to cumulative improvements over time.

Educating clients on the need for ongoing sessions helps set realistic expectations and ensures they experience the full benefits of the therapy.

Myth #3: Red Light Therapy Is Dangerous

The Truth:
This is one of the most common red light therapy myths. In reality, RLT is non-invasive, painless, and considered extremely safe for all skin types when used correctly. Unlike UV rays, red light wavelengths do not damage the skin or increase the risk of cancer.

Myth #4: Red Light Therapy Can Treat Every Condition

The Truth:
While RLT is effective for many concerns, such as reducing wrinkles, improving skin texture, and relieving muscle pain, it’s not a universal cure-all. Some claims, like its ability to replace traditional medical treatments or instantly cure severe conditions, are exaggerated.
